Repack: This term has two primary meanings depending on the context of the release:
Correction: A "repack" is often a corrected version released by the same group if the original version had technical flaws, such as missing frames or audio sync issues.
Compression: It can also mean the files were compressed into a smaller size to make downloading faster, a practice common for games and high-definition video. Risks and Safety Considerations
